Rapidly changing technology landscape
The rapidly changing technology landscape can pose many challenges for IT consultants. Keeping up with the latest trends and advancements can be difficult, especially when clients have high expectations for quick solutions. It can be frustrating when new technologies emerge and old ones become obsolete, making it hard to stay ahead of the curve. Additionally, the pressure to deliver results quickly can lead to stress and burnout for consultants. Despite these challenges, IT consultants must adapt and learn new skills to remain competitive in the industry. It's important to stay informed, network with other professionals, and constantly improve one's expertise. With perseverance and determination, consultants can overcome these obstacles and succeed in this fast-paced field!
Balancing multiple projects and deadlines
Balancing multiple projects and deadlines can be a real challenge for IT consultants. It's like juggling a bunch of balls at once and trying not to drop any! Sometimes, it feels like there's just not enough time in the day to get everything done. And when you're working on multiple projects, it can be easy to get overwhelmed and stressed out. But with some careful planning and prioritization, it is possible to manage your workload effectively.
One common challenge faced by IT consultants is trying to keep track of all the different deadlines and deliverables for each project. It's easy to lose sight of what needs to be done when you have so many things on your plate. Another challenge is dealing with unexpected issues that arise during a project, which can throw off your timeline and cause delays.
To overcome these challenges, it's important to stay organized and create a clear plan of action for each project. This can help you stay on track and ensure that you meet all of your deadlines. It's also helpful to communicate with your team members and clients regularly to keep everyone on the same page. And don't forget to take breaks and give yourself some time to recharge – burning yourself out won't help anyone!
In conclusion, balancing multiple projects and deadlines is no easy feat, but with some strategic planning and good time management skills, it is possible to stay on top of your workload and deliver high-quality results. So, keep calm and carry on – you've got this!
Client communication and expectations
Client communication and expectations can be a tricky thing for IT consultants to manage. It's important to make sure that clients understand what can and cannot be done! One common challenge faced by IT consultants is when clients have unrealistic expectations. They may think that a project can be completed in a shorter amount of time than is actually possible. Another challenge is when clients do not communicate their needs clearly, leading to misunderstandings and delays. It's crucial for consultants to set clear boundaries and manage expectations from the start. By being proactive in communication and setting realistic timelines, consultants can avoid many of these challenges. So, next time you're working with a client, make sure to keep the lines of communication open and set clear expectations to ensure a successful project outcome!
Managing client relationships
Managing client relationships can be a tough task for IT consultants, ain't it? There are many challenges faced in this field, including communication issues, unrealistic expectations, and lack of trust. It's important to build a strong rapport with clients and understand their needs in order to deliver successful projects. One common challenge is dealing with clients who have little knowledge of technology, making it difficult to explain complex concepts in a way they can understand. Another challenge is managing client expectations, as they may have unreasonable demands or timelines. Trust is also a key factor in client relationships, as without it, projects can quickly go off track. By being proactive, setting clear expectations, and maintaining open communication, IT consultants can overcome these challenges and build successful partnerships with their clients!

Finding new clients and business opportunities
Finding new clients and business opportunities can be a real struggle for IT consultants! With so much competition out there, it can be hard to stand out and catch the attention of potential clients. But don't worry, there are ways to overcome these common challenges and grow your business.
One of the biggest issues IT consultants face is getting their foot in the door with new clients. Many businesses already have established relationships with other consultants or may not see the need for your services. However, by networking and reaching out to potential clients, you can show them the value you can bring to their organization.

Ensuring data security and compliance
Ensuring data security and compliance can be a real struggle for IT consultants! With the constant threat of cyber attacks and strict regulations, it can feel like an uphill battle. One common challenge faced by IT consultants is keeping up with ever-changing security protocols and compliance standards. It's not easy to stay on top of all the latest updates and requirements, especially when you're juggling multiple clients and projects.
